The Efficiency Network, Inc. (TEN)is an independent energy-focused design/build contractor that provides building infrastructure upgrades and energy projects services to state, local, and federal government, K-12 education, higher education, healthcare, and large commercial and industrial customers. We help our clients address deferred maintenance, invest in infrastructure, improve the efficiency and sustainability of their buildings, and make their operations more resilient. TEN applies state of the art technology, engineering, construction and project management concepts and practices, along with creative financing and ownership solutions, to deliver projects quickly and efficiently. TEN is part of the Duquesne Light Holdings, Inc. family of companies. Job Title: Marketing Coordinator I Summary: Reporting to The Efficiency Network's (TEN) Senior Vice President of Development, the Marketing Coordinator (Assistant) supports the Company's effort to produce graphics and infographics, compelling presentations and other marketing materials such as case studies, conference materials, and social media engagement. The Marketing Coordinator (Assistant) will work collaboratively with TEN's proposal, sales and technical teams to prepare material that is effective in demonstrating the Company's capabilities. This is a part-time position, with the successful candidate working at least 30 hours per week. The successful candidate may work in a hybrid or remote work environment.
